I had the opportunity last night to take photos at the opening night of the WAMi festival. For those who don't know it’s the Western Australian Music Industry week to showcase and award those in the Western Australian music industry. This was something a little different to what I normally do, since I am used to photographing DJ's in clubs, so the live music was a nice change of scene.
